The Master of Science in Biotechnology at Johns Hopkins University offers a transformative educational journey designed for aspiring professionals eager to make impactful contributions in the field of biotechnology. This comprehensive program merges theoretical knowledge with practical application, equipping students with the essential skills needed to succeed in a rapidly evolving industry. With a duration of 12 months, students engage in an immersive curriculum that covers a broad spectrum of topics, ranging from molecular biology to bioinformatics, thus allowing them to explore various facets of biotechnology.

The curriculum includes specialized courses like Genetic Engineering, Biochemical Analysis, and Biotechnology in Drug Development. Admission to the Master of Science in Biotechnology program requires a bachelor's degree in a related field, such as biology or chemistry, along with a strong academic record. Applicants must also submit a Statement of Purpose, an Academic Letter of Recommendation, and a current Resume. To ensure proficiency in English, international applicants are required to submit standardized English test scores from exams such as TOEFL (minimum score: 100), IELTS (minimum score: 7.0), or PTE (minimum score: 68).
